Writing What You Know When You Don't Know Anything


Listen Later

Word of the Week: Zenosyne

In this week's episode, Ash and Karissa discuss the concept "write what you know" as well as whether or not this is really an applicable writing practice, and if so, how. From discussions over what is considered valuable "life experience" to genre-specific requirements for certain fields of knowledge, the hosts do their best to spread some light and encouragement on this heavily debated topic.
